Cronos is the native token of the Cronos ecosystem, a high-performance network designed to power dApps and bridge users into Web3. It serves as a utility token for the Crypto.com platform, offering benefits like staking rewards and lower fees. CRO powers transactions across its EVM-compatible blockchain.

It offers a wide range of financial services, including lending, borrowing, automated market making (AMM), and asset management. Developed by Scallop Labs, which has a team of experts in DeFi, cybersecurity, and fintech, Scallop has attracted support from notable investors such as CMS Holdings, 6th Man Ventures, KuCoin Labs, and Mysten Labs. Additionally, it is the first DeFi project to receive an official grant from the Sui Foundation, highlighting its institutional-grade quality and strong security features.
